Duck egg blue is a timeless and versatile color that evokes a sense of serenity and sophistication. When paired with the transformative power of chalk paint, it becomes a canvas for endless possibilities in home decor. This article delves into the captivating world of duck egg blue chalk paint, exploring its unique charm, practical applications, and inspiring ideas to elevate your home’s aesthetic.

The Allure of Duck Egg Blue Chalk Paint

Duck egg blue is a soft, muted shade of blue that carries a delicate, almost ethereal quality. Unlike bolder blues, it doesn’t overwhelm a space but rather adds a touch of tranquility and elegance. This subtle hue effortlessly blends with various design styles, from farmhouse chic to coastal contemporary. Chalk paint, with its matte finish and ability to adhere to almost any surface, further enhances the versatility of duck egg blue, allowing you to transform furniture, walls, and even accessories with ease.

Unveiling the Versatility of Duck Egg Blue Chalk Paint

Duck egg blue chalk paint is an incredibly versatile tool for home decor enthusiasts. Its ability to be distressed, layered, and combined with other colors opens a world of creative opportunities.

1. Furniture Makeovers:

  • Vintage Finds: Duck egg blue chalk paint breathes new life into vintage furniture pieces, giving them a fresh and modern appeal. Consider using it to revamp a distressed dresser, an old dining table, or even a vintage vanity.
  • Statement Pieces: Transform a plain sofa, a coffee table, or a headboard with a coat of duck egg blue chalk paint. The muted hue creates a sophisticated focal point without overwhelming the room.
  • Accent Furniture: Use duck egg blue chalk paint to highlight accent pieces like side tables, chairs, or bookshelves, adding a subtle touch of color and personality to your space.

2. Wall Transformations:

  • Accent Walls: Create a captivating focal point in your living room, bedroom, or dining area by painting a single wall in duck egg blue chalk paint. Its calming effect creates a soothing atmosphere.
  • Trim and Moldings: Highlight architectural details like trim and moldings with a coat of duck egg blue chalk paint for a subtle yet elegant touch.

Tips for Working with Duck Egg Blue Chalk Paint

  • Preparation is Key: Proper surface preparation is essential for achieving a smooth and lasting finish. Clean and lightly sand the surface before applying chalk paint.
  • Thinning the Paint: For a more fluid application, thin the chalk paint with water. This is especially helpful for achieving a distressed or layered look.
  • Multiple Coats: Apply multiple thin coats of chalk paint for optimal coverage and a smooth finish. Allow each coat to dry completely before applying the next.
  • Distressing Techniques: To create a vintage or rustic look, distress the chalk paint using sandpaper, steel wool, or a sanding block.
  • Sealing the Finish: Seal the chalk paint with a clear wax or sealant to protect it from scratches and spills.
